- The distance between Richmond/ Byrd, Va, Usa and Patos De Minas, Brazil is approximately 7,023 km or 4,364 mi.
- To reach Richmond/ Byrd, Va in this distance one would set out from Patos De Minas bearing 332.9° or NN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Richmond/ Byrd, Va bearing 327° or NNW .
- Richmond/ Byrd, Va has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Patos De Minas has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w).
- Richmond/ Byrd, Va is in or near the warm temperate moist forest biome whereas Patos De Minas is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ome.
- The average annual temperature is 6.8 °C (12.2°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 18.8 °C (33.8°F) more in Richmond/ Byrd, Va.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 378.1 mm (14.9 in) less which is equivalent to 378.1 l/m² (9.28 US gal/ft²) or 3,781,000 l/ha (404,214 US gal/ac) less. About 3/4 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 16.5° lower in Richmond/ Byrd, Va than in Patos De Minas.
